News of basketball great Kobe Bryant's death in a helicopter crash spread quickly yesterday but close friend Tiger Woods was unaware of the tragedy until hours later.
Woods was playing his final round at the 2020 Farmers Insurance Open at Torrey Pines when the accident happened.
He finished with a two-under 70 and moments after stepping off the 18th, caddie Joe LaCava delivered the news - a heartbreaking moment caught on camera.
"I have something shocking to tell you," LaCava began.
"Kobe Bryant died in a helicopter crash this morning."
The information took Woods back.
"Excuse me?" the golfer responded.
LaCava then went into more detail about the incident as the pair walked off before Woods gave an interview minutes later about his late friend, commonly referred to as 'The Black Mamba'.
Woods told CBS Sports he did not know until Joey just told him.
He says he did not understand why people in the gallery were saying, 'Do it for Mamba, adding now he understands.
